Innovative Materials Used in Luggage Production

Modern travel gear increasingly incorporates advanced materials that enhance durability and functionality. The use of these innovative substances not only improves the overall performance of travel cases but also impacts their weight and design.

One such material making waves in the industry is polycarbonate. This lightweight thermoplastic is known for its high impact resistance, making it ideal for protecting personal belongings during transit. Additionally, polycarbonate can be molded into sleek shapes, allowing for a stylish appearance while maintaining strength.

Other Notable Materials

  • Ballistic Nylon: Originally designed for military use, this fabric offers exceptional abrasion resistance and durability.
  • Recycled PET: Sourced from plastic bottles, this eco-friendly option contributes to sustainability while still providing strength and water resistance.
  • Leather Alternatives: Vegan leathers made from materials like pineapple fibers or cork are gaining popularity for their aesthetic appeal and lower environmental impact.
  • Aluminum: Often used in high-end cases, aluminum provides a sleek, modern design along with unmatched sturdiness.

Additionally, innovative coatings are being applied to enhance weather resistance. Materials treated with water-repellent finishes help protect contents from moisture. These advancements reflect a growing emphasis on functionality without compromising style.

With continuous research and development, the future of travel gear promises even more exciting materials that prioritize both performance and sustainability, catering to the evolving needs of travelers worldwide.

What are the key features to look for in a high-quality luggage manufacturer?

When choosing a luggage manufacturer, several key features should be taken into account. First, consider the materials used in the production of the luggage. High-quality manufacturers often use durable materials such as polycarbonate or ballistic nylon that can withstand wear and tear. Second, check the warranty offered by the manufacturer, as a longer warranty often indicates confidence in the product’s durability. Third, look for innovative features like built-in TSA-approved locks, expandable compartments, and smooth-rolling wheels for ease of transport. Lastly, customer reviews and brand reputation can provide insights into the reliability and performance of the luggage.

Which luggage brands are currently considered the best in the market?

Several brands are frequently recognized for their excellence in luggage manufacturing. Brands like Samsonite and Rimowa stand out for their innovative designs and durability. Tumi is well-regarded for its premium materials and sleek aesthetics, while Away has gained popularity for its modern look and practical features. Other notable brands include Travelpro, known for its reliability, and Briggs & Riley, which offers a lifetime warranty on its products. Each of these brands has its strengths, making them popular choices among travelers looking for quality luggage.

How do I determine the right size of luggage for my travel needs?

Choosing the right size of luggage depends on several factors, including the length of your trip and the type of transportation you will use. For weekend getaways, a carry-on size (usually around 20-22 inches) is often sufficient. For longer trips, a medium-sized suitcase (24-26 inches) might be more appropriate, allowing for additional clothing and essentials. If you plan to check your luggage, consider a larger option (28 inches or more); however, ensure it complies with airline size restrictions. Additionally, think about how much you typically pack and whether you prefer extra space for souvenirs or new purchases. Always check the airline’s baggage policies to avoid extra fees.
